Scout454 Posted December 9, 2008 Share Posted December 9, 2008 Round count last year was well over 400 (450?). It is the most physically demanding match I've shot in the past 20 years - especially for the RO's. And the stage denise is referring to? Start on the top of a hill with a loaded shotgun and while moving 30 yards laterally, engage 26 shotgun targets. Transition to tour handgun and again while moving laterally about 20 yards, engage 14 paper targets. Dump the handgun, grab your rifle and engage 10 paper targets while moving laterally over 60 to 70 yards. Then sprint 50 yards and from a low barricade, you have tiny rifle poppers and 6" Colt plates down both sides from 80 to 120 yards. Stuck in the middle of all this are 4 flash targets at around 300 yards. Yeah, lots of bullets and at the end of the day you are damned tired. But what a blast!
